1.
USB Type-C® port (for maintenance and service use)
Note
No power is supplied through the USB Type-C port. Do not connect any device, such as a mobile battery pack, to the port for
power supply purposes to avoid a malfunction.
2.
DIGITAL/ANALOG switch
Select the digital or analog input type.
If your camera is compatible with the digital audio interface of the Multi Interface Shoe, set the switch to
"DIGITAL."
Digital signal transmission between this unit and the camera has the following merits over analog signal
transmission that is enabled by the DIGITAL/ANALOG switch being set to "ANALOG."
Audio recording with less noise
Less audio delay during recording
Recording with 24-bit audio (only available in combination with the compatible camera)
Recording with channel 3 and channel 4 (only available in combination with the compatible camera)
Note
Movies recorded with 24-bit audio may not be played back normally on devices or software incompatible with 24-bit
audio, resulting in unexpectedly loud volumes or no sound.
If your camera is not compatible with the digital audio interface of the Multi Interface Shoe, set the switch to
"ANALOG."
When the message "This accessory is not supported by the device and cannot be used." is displayed on the
camera, set the switch to "ANALOG."
